No sure at all about the public buses or taxis as I haven't taken either yet. Someone else would be more qualified to answer that. Only thing I noticed about the taxis was that there are three separate booths on Level 1 and lots and lots of taxis without hardly any passengers. There was no line at any of the three booths. The sign there clearly said that within Bangkok the price was the meter plus 50 Baht plus any toll charges, and that if your destination is outside of Bangkok you must negotiate a price with the driver.

coconutty At those hours your only choice would be a taxi. The fare to the Banglamphu district will likely be ~ 300 baht all in (includes tolls and 50 baht taxi fee).
